Meet ABIM’s new leader: maintaining credibility with patients
Author(s)Chris Mazzolini
A conversation with Furman S. McDonald, MD, MPH.
Advertisement
ABIM has a role in preserving the relationship between patients and doctors. Physician expertise matters and it allows patients to trust in their doctors, said incoming President and CEO Furman S. McDonald, MD, MPH, who will take the role on Sept. 1.
